a little math problem

Fresh Mango contains 70% water by weight whereas dry mango contains 10% water by weight. What is the weight of dry mango that can be obtained from 20 kg of Fresh Mango?

If 20 kg of mango is 70% water, then you have 6 kg that is "not water."

But when you dry the mango you can't get down to just 6 kg; we know there will be some water left and the resulting substance will be 10% water by weight.

The rest is algebra:

X = 6 + .10X

.9X = 6

X = 6/.9

X = 6.66
